The latest victim in 2005 of road rage in the city is Sharad Kelkar. The actor was driving from Lokhandwala to Saki Naka for a shoot, when an approaching taxi banged into his Ford Ikon.

How it happened

"This was some time around 8 am, on Wednesday morning when I was on my way to work," says Sharad.

"There is a petrol pump on the highway, towards Andheri (East), where the accident happened. I was at the signal and my car was the first vehicle in line. As soon as it turned green, I started moving ahead. There was a BEST bus on my left, so I was making sure I drove straight.

All of a sudden, out of nowhere, a taxi appeared in front, and I immediately applied the brakes. But by the time my car could halt, the taxi had already rammed into the front."

Sharad says he didn't want to get into an argument, as the taxi driver was old and the accident had stalled traffic at the junction. "The taxi also suffered some damage, but I didn't want to create a scene - I had already wasted 20 minutes, and was late for my shoot."

Repairs can wait

How did his wife Kirti, react to the news? "She was definitely shocked, but glad to know I wasn't hurt. I was wearing a seatbelt, so I had just a minor injury on my knee."

Sharad won't be able to take his car to the garage for a few days. "I am doing two shows now, so need to keep travelling. Kirti has her own car; I cannot give up mine for the time being."
